Pasta-green- what type? I like a good pasta salad,but the problem I encounter is starchy so I found the success lies in the dressing. I mix a package of Italian dressing with just half the oil vinegar and water and add that to the pasta while it is still warm,then refrigerate then add what ever else. I like broccoli

Romain lettuce
baby spinach
dried cranberries
sliced red, yellow or orange bell pepper
almond slices
a balsamic vinegar salad dressing (';Newman's Own'; is a good brand)
I have no real set amount of how much of each ingredient I put in, it all depends on how many people you are serving or how much you like each ingredient.
and if you want to make a meal out of it add a salmon fillet to it.....
2 salmon fillets
juice from 1 lemon
salt and pepper to taste
3 cloves (crushed) garlic
2 tablespoons of olive oil
mix the last 4 ingredients in a bowl, put the salmon in a zip lock bag, add the sauce from the bowl into the bag and mix around. Put into the fridge for about 4 hours to marinate.
Then cook anyway you like, ie. oven (~350 degrees), stove top, BBQ.
Personally I think the BBQ is the best! The length of cooking time depends on the thickness of the fish. Usually 10-20 minutes....it is done when the fish flakes. But it will keep cooking when you take it off the heat, so try not to over cook the salmon, or it will be dry.

Here are a couple of my favorites:
Spinach Salad:
2 bunches baby spinach, cleaned and stemmed
1 4oz container feta cheese
1/2 cup chopped candied walnuts
1 can mandarin oranges, drained
5 slices crumbled cooked bacon, drained (opt.)
1/2 -3/4 cup French Dressing
Toss the above together and serve immediately. Yummy!
Antipasti Pasta Salad:
1 box Rotelle pasta, cooked al dente and cooled
1 bottle Berensteins Light Cheese Fantastico Dressing
1 large red bell pepper, seeded and chopped
1 bunch green onions, chopped
1 large can sliced black olives, drained
1 4oz container feta cheese
1 chub dry salami, cubed
Mix the above together and chill for several hours. Stir before serving. Yum!

FOR SALAD:
I just buy the pre-mixed bag stuff.
Add in: crumbled tortilla chips (1/4 cup)
Fiesta corn cold (1/4 cup)
Shredded Cheese (1/4 cup)
FOR CHICKEN:
Marinate chicken breast in tabasco for 2-4 hours. Then grill... this will make a spicy chicken breast.
Cut into strips and put on top of salad mixture.
FOR QUESADILLAS:
Take a large flour tortilla in skillet, put cheese (1/2 cup) on 1/2 of the tortilla, flip it in half, melt cheese. Cut into 4 quarters. Place around the plate at 12, 3, 6, 9 (like a clock).
DRESSING: (MUST HAVE!!!!)
1/8 cup ranch dressing
1/8 cup salsa
2 tablespoons tabasco
mix all together and serve.

Here is a simple summer salad:
1 lb. tomatillos, chopped into about 1/2 inch pieces
1/2 onion, finely chopped
handful of fresh cilantro, chopped
A couple jalepenos, chopped
Toss with olive oil and salt to taste
Serve with crumbled queso anejo

I make this salad all the time:
2 cups sliced strawberries
1 head of romaine chopped (you can also use the bag)
1 cup crumbled bleu cheese
1 cup walnuts (candied or not)
1 cup Brianna's poppyseed dressing
Throw all of those in a big bowl, toss it up and enjoy! It's fabulous.
Black bean %26amp; mango chicken salad
16 oz. black beans, drained
10 oz. frozen corn
1 C chopped mango
1/2 lb. grilled chicken
1/2 C chopped red pepper
1/3 C fresh cilantro
1/3 C red onion
1/4 C lime juice
1 C Italian dressing
Toss all ingredients together, refrigerate at least an hour and serve in a large bowl with chips or crackers.
Mixed baby salad greens OR spinach .... carmelized sliced almonds OR walnuts (stir fry the nuts in sugar, until sugar melts %26amp; coats the nuts) ... drained mandarin oranges OR sliced strawberries or raspberries ... thinly sliced red onion ......Balsamic Vignarette dressing OR Raspberry-Walnut Vignarette dressing
